Sovereign Hill
Allow at least a day to explore Sovereign Hill, the magnificent reconstructed township of Ballarat in the 1850s, built on the site of one of its richest mines.
Pan for gold, take an underground mine tour, ride in a Cobb and Co coach, wander through old-style buildings and soak up the atmosphere of a bygone era.
Gold Museum
Ballarat's fascinating Gold Museum, located across the road from Sovereign Hill, displays early photos and paintings, manuscripts and books, and one of
the country's finest collections of gold coins and gold nuggets.
